tdesktop/.github/workflows/winget.yml

21 lines
700 B
YAML
Raw Normal View History

2022-05-07 03:44:04 +00:00
name: Publish to WinGet
on:
release:
2022-07-23 15:56:23 +00:00
types: [released, prereleased]
2022-05-07 03:44:04 +00:00
jobs:
publish:
runs-on: windows-latest # action can only be run on windows
steps:
2022-07-23 15:56:23 +00:00
- if: github.event.action == 'released'
2022-08-05 14:41:31 +00:00
uses: telegramdesktop/winget-releaser@main
2022-05-07 03:44:04 +00:00
with:
identifier: Telegram.TelegramDesktop
installers-regex: 't(setup|portable).*(exe|zip)$'
2022-05-07 03:44:04 +00:00
token: ${{ secrets.WINGET_TOKEN }}
2022-07-23 15:56:23 +00:00
- if: github.event.action == 'prereleased'
2022-08-05 14:41:31 +00:00
uses: telegramdesktop/winget-releaser@main
2022-07-23 15:56:23 +00:00
with:
identifier: Telegram.TelegramDesktop.Beta
installers-regex: 't(setup|portable).*(exe|zip)$'
2022-07-23 15:56:23 +00:00
token: ${{ secrets.WINGET_TOKEN }}